The number of graduates who scored 100 points on the Unified State Exam in history increased from 155 last year to 260 this year. This was announced on June 23 by Russian Minister of Education Sergey Kravtsov at the II World Congress of School History Teachers.
"The number of history students has increased, and we are also pleased about this: from 155 people last year to 260 this year," TASS quoted Kravtsov as saying.
The minister also said that the average test score of the Unified State Exam in history in 2026 increased from 55.8 to 57.8, and the share of high-scoring students increased from 11.7% to 15%.
The press service of the Ministry of Education of Russia reported on June 18 that according to the results of the main period of the Unified State Exam in history, literature, Russian language and chemistry, 5,263 people received the maximum score of 100 points.
The first results for the Unified State Exam in 2026 began to arrive to graduates on June 15, and the very next day it became known about the increase in the number of history students in the country. This indicator increased by 4% compared to the previous one.
